Abstract

The objective of this study was to measure the effects of mercury pollution due to the waste from gold mining in Kahayan river by using Kapuas Murung river in Central Kalimantan as control. This study was a cross-sectional observational study by means of sampling approach to determine the level of exposure, and comparison of neurological disorder occurred in exposed group to those in control group. Each group consisted of 30 samples. Results revealed that mercury content in the river had been above the permissible threshold recommended by life environmental department in Indonesia, showing the occurrence of pollution as indicated by the difference between exposed and control group (p = 0,000). Mercury content in catfish (A,fys/mx nemurus), however. remained under the maximum level of consumable fish as recommended by WHO, on which both group showed signify difference (p = 0,01 1). Mercury content in hair had been under the permissible threshold, on which both group showed difference (p = 0,000). Neurological disorders due to mercury intoxication, which were different in both group, were paraesthesia, in exposed group was 63.3 % and control group 26.7 % (p = 0,009); behavior abnormality/neurops_ychiatric disorder, in exposed group 76.7 % and in control group 26.7 % (p = 0.000); hearing disorder, in exposed group 23.3 5 and in control group 3,3 % (p = 0,05); and eye disorder, in exposed group 50.0 % and in control group 6.77 % (p = 0.001).
